Output d762bd7a8bef85723bbfd787ec6d90cc5e999d9cdcfe83b98b2ee00c60accf0e:2

value
360453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71ff2ca0858db66f0e5919ccd3da3b46d097869 OP_EQUAL
address
3QDh6jqDR5PMawhq1NQCBtMjVxkXQvgqoU
transaction
d762bd7a8bef85723bbfd787ec6d90cc5e999d9cdcfe83b98b2ee00c60accf0e
confirmations
264010
spent
true